Responsibilities
  • Responsible for new product introduction (NPI) including time studies, equipment selection, line balance data, tooling specifications, manpower requirements, and all aspects of process development.
  • Develop methods of operation to increase efficiency and reduce costs by studying product designs, materials, machines, and workflow.
  • Design and develop fixtures, jigs, and tools to facilitate efficient assembly or processing of products.
  • Ensure compliance with established standards, policies, and practices relating to quality, safety, ergonomics, etc.
  • Establish production schedules based on production requirements and available resources.
  • Work closely with Operations Management to resolve all issues related to throughput, quality, and plant operations.
  • Maintain accurate records and reports of activities such as labor utilization, machine performance, production levels, defective rates, etc.
  • Provide assistance in maintaining ISO certification.
  • Assist with electrical applications such as troubleshooting electrical wiring and testing of motors and control devices.
  • Work safely around moving parts, electrical installations, hot surfaces, and sharp objects.
  • Physical presence onsite in a fast‑paced environment.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or a related discipline.
  • Minimum 5 years of hands‑on professional experience in manufacturing environment.
  • Strong knowledge of electrical concepts such as wiring layouts, electrical design, schematics, etc.
  • Experience in electronics manufacturing highly desired.
  • Ability to read, interpret, and execute schematics.
  • Decision‑making skills in a high‑volume, fast‑paced environment.
  • Leadership experience managing technicians and manufacturing personnel.
  • Strong communication and training skills.
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D or Solid Works.
